A nice, polished game!
The only thing that I think was missing about this game is a bit more level design. Since the core gameplay mechanic is simple and there weren't many variations inside the levels, it was easy to solve the levels the second I looked at them. However, this doesn't prevent this game from being awesome!
Although I think the core gameplay loops need a little more variety, the game was well-polished and fun. Everything was working as intended, and I enjoyed each level. I found the health system a bit pointless, a "do it perfect or lose it" approach I think would suit more to a puzzle game like this. Visuals via post-processing were great, and I think the game has a great amount of "geometry" in it.
Solid entry, well done!